The four major enzymeinducing aeds carbamazepine, phenytoin, phenobarbital and primidone stimulate the metabolism and reduce the serum concentration of most other concurrently administered aeds, most notably valproic acid 23, 24, tiagabine, ethosuximide, lamotrigine 27, 28, topiramate, oxcarbazepine and its active monohydroxyderivative mhd, zonisamide, felbamate and many benzodiazepine drugs 33, 34.
